"Renowned" is the adjectival form of the noun "renown".
The word renown is the noun form. The adjective is renowned.
"World renown" is a noun -- "A man of world renown." "World renowned" is the descriptive adjective phrase -- "The world renowned Copper Canyon in Mexico."
